Hi .. Im looking for some advice!
Im currently living in Ireland, with the hope of moving to Canada. My only problem is im not sure what visa would apply to us.
Myself and my partner (not married) and our 2 year old son are hoping all going together. But have no clue as to what visa would suit best.
Any advice would be so much appreciated

If you're looking to make a permanent move to Canada, you will need to apply for permanent residency through one of Canada's PR programs (there are several). You'll need to research the requirements to understand what it takes to qualify and apply. There is no specific stream for individuals from Ireland - country of origin is irrelevant. Recommend you start by researching the Express Entry program. Details are in the link below.
